Black Jetbead

Botanical Name
Rhodotypos scandens
Hardiness
Zones 4 to 8
Height
3 to 6 feet
Width
4 to 9 feet
Flowers
Late spring: white
Fruit
Black drupe, persist
Light
Full sun to shade
Soil
Average, well-drained
Planting & Care
  • Easily transplanted
  • Very tolerant of pollution and a variety of soil conditions
  • Good for shady areas
Problems
None serious
